That is odd that you find Gold Spill to be similar to Silver Dusk. One should be beigey-gold and the other is silver... Regardless, if you don't think they are different enough to warrent having both, return the MSF. Anything you can do with a ILP you can do with a MSF, namely highlighting the cheeks, eyes, and body. MSF's often have color so they can also be used as a blush, but the Iridescent Powders dont have color payoff, only a shimmer. I personally didn't think MSF had a color payoff either.
